Output 21703962e580476b8649dbefc354be7b917bb7d815f276646df51719ffb941b3:2

value
841573843
script pubkey
OP_0 OP_PUSHBYTES_20 746429db899f67fadf94d7d9f75aa083d6abe171
address
tb1qw3jznkufnanl4hu56lvlwk4qs0t2hct3lcevnd
transaction
21703962e580476b8649dbefc354be7b917bb7d815f276646df51719ffb941b3
confirmations
77705
spent
true